There were 40 lawyers with active licenses to practice in Navajo County as of July, according to the State Bar of Arizona.

This is unchanged from June.

Within Navajo County, Holbrook had the highest number of lawyers with active licenses during July (13).

Data refers to all lawyers who were actively practicing during this period.

As of July 1, 2025, average lawyer salaries in Arizona ranged from $97,523 for an entry-level attorney handling routine legal work (Attorney I) to $246,388 for highly experienced attorneys managing complex cases with significant autonomy (Attorney V). Mid-level attorneys, such as those in Attorney III roles—who handle highly complex legal work with moderate supervision—earned on average $182,571 in Arizona, compared to $174,969 nationwide.

Arizona had the fourth-lowest number of lawyers per capita in the U.S., with about 2.14 lawyers per 1,000 residents, compared to the national average of 3.81.
